FIA WEC – The 2019-2020 season is off and running

Today, Sunday 1 September at noon local time, the Silverstone rounds kicks off the 2019-2020 season of the FIA World Endurance Championship.

For Season 8 of the FIA World Endurance Championship, one of several official photos was taken of the drivers and officials gathered at the traditional pre-race briefing. The start at the 4 Hours of Silverstone will be given today at noon local time to kick off the eight-round championship, with the 2020 24 Hours of Le Mans serving as the Super Finale on 13-14 June.

The Season 8 calendar is as follows: 4 Hours of Silverstone (1 September), 6 Hours of Fuji (6 October), 4 Hours of Shanghai (10 November), 8 Hours of Bahrain (14 December), 6 Hours of São Paulo (1 February), 1000 Miles of Sebring (20 March), Total 6 Hours of Spa-Francorchamps (25 April) and 24 Hours of Le Mans (13-14 June).  

Among the 2019-2020 season rookies figures Guy Smith (age 44), winner at the 2003 24 Hours of Le Mans with Bentley, competing in the LMP1 class with Team LNT at the wheel of a Ginetta G60-LT-P1-AER.
